Who Needs Inpatient Alcohol and Drug Treatment in Urich, Missouri?

Inpatient drug rehabilitation centers in Urich are suited for many individuals with drug and alcohol use disorders. However, they tend to be more successful for addicts who are also battling co-occurring mental health conditions. Such patients may require round the clock care and medical oversight - which may not be available in an outpatient facility.

In the same way, if you have participated in drug and alcohol addiction rehab in the past through an outpatient program or if you tried inpatient rehab but this wasn't successful, then it is highly likely that you could benefit from a more extended stay in a residential treatment program.

Teens, in specific, also benefit from these programs because they typically have severe mental health conditions co-occurring with their substance use disorders. As such, they might require rehab that addresses both conditions before they can recover fully.

Disadvantages of Inpatient Drug Treatment

Inpatient programs are offered in a number of settings - including but not limited to mental health facilities and hospitals. Others are luxury or executive models and may provide many amenities and services to make your journey to recovery smoother.

However, you might not benefit from these programs if:

You have concerns that you will be separated from your family, friends, social life, and professional commitments for too long.

You think that the cost of rehab at an inpatient drug rehab facility in Urich, MO. is too high for you to afford.

You would first like to try recovering through an outpatient facility before you commit to residential drug addiction treatment.

However, in most cases, inpatient drug treatment tends to work successfully and has been proven time and time again to result in better outcomes overall. This is why it is the most often recommended type of treatment available for individuals searching for recovery after months or years of intensive substance abuse and drug and alcohol addiction. The Crittenton Children's Center is located in Kansas City, MO. Since it was established in 1896, it has been providing psychiatric and behavioral health care services to the teens and children living in the local community, as well as to their families and loved ones. It works with the St. Luke's Hospital of Kansas City.
